MPESB Group 5 Recruitment 2024: Registration begins for 1,170 posts; apply by January 13 at esb.mp.gov.in

MPESB group 5 recruitment test 2024 is scheduled to be held on February 15, 2025, in two shifts.
NEW DELHI: The Madhya Pradesh Employees Selection Board (MPESB) has begun the registration process for the group 5 recruitment exam 2024. MPESB group 5 recruitment test 2024 will be conducted on February 15, 2025, for staff nurses, paramedical, and other posts.
As per the schedule, the last date to register for the recruitment exam is January 13, 2025. Eligible candidates can register for the MPESB group 5 recruitment exam 2024 through the official website, esb.mp.gov.in.
The board has also opened the MPESB group 5 application correction window to make changes to the application form. The last date to edit the MPESB group 5 application form 2025 is January 18, 2025. The recruitment drive aims to fill a total of 1,170 vacancies for various group 5 posts.
MPESB Group 5 Recruitment 2024: Application fee
To register for the MPESB group 5 recruitment exam 2024, candidates from the unreserved category will have to pay an application fee of Rs 500. Candidates from Other Backward Classes (OBC), Economically Weaker Sections (EWS), Scheduled Castes (SC), and Scheduled Tribes (ST) categories are required to pay Rs. 250.
“For candidates filling online applications through kiosks, a portal fee of Rs 60 will be payable on the MP Online portal. Additionally, registered citizen users logging in through kiosks to fill out the form will need to pay a portal fee of Rs 20,” the official notification read.

MPESB group 5 2024 exam timing
The MPESB group 5 recruitment exam 2024 will take place in two sessions. The first session exam will take place from 9 am to 11 am. Candidates will have to report to the exam centre between 7 am and 8 am. Candidates will be allotted 10 minutes from 8:50 am to 9:00 am for reading instructions.
For the second session, candidates will have to report to the exam centre from 1 pm to 2 pm. Candidates will get 10 minutes from 2:50 pm to 3:00 pm for reading instructions, and the MPESB group 5 session 2 exam will take place from 3 pm to 5 pm.
